Background
The medium filter is composed of a plurality of standard high-speed sand cylinder units, a unique water distributor and a unique water collector are arranged in the medium filter, a unique bidirectional automatic flushing valve is provided, and the full-automatic program control of backwashing of the plurality of standard high-speed sand cylinders one by one in the normal system operation can be realized. Has the advantages of small water consumption for back washing, convenient equipment installation, easy operation and the like. The equipment has large flow and does not need maintenance. According to different user requirements, there are two series of vertical type and horizontal type. It is suitable for water treatment of industrial and civil circulating water systems.
During the use process, pressure is applied to the interior of the filter to achieve the purpose of filtering. Detailed Description
Example (b): a medium filter, see fig. 1 and 2, comprises a machine body 1, wherein a vertically arranged maintenance pipe 11 which communicates the inside of the machine body 1 with the outside is fixedly arranged on the top surface of the machine body 1, the bottom end of the maintenance pipe 11 is fixedly arranged on the top surface of the machine body 1, and a cover body 12 is arranged at the top end of the maintenance pipe 11. Examine and repair four elevating assembly 2 of fixedly connected with on 11 organism 1 top surfaces all around of pipe, elevating assembly 2 is including setting firmly sleeve 211 on 1 top surface of organism and the king-rod 21 of pegging graft with sleeve 211, and the equal vertical setting of king-rod 21 and sleeve 211 and the setting of the two coaxial line. The bottom of well pole 21 is pegged graft inside sleeve 211, and four even along the circumference distribution of lifting unit 2 are examining and repairing pipe 11 four lifting unit 2's all around connecting rod 3 of common fixedly connected with in top, and connecting rod 3 is including being the horizontal cross form horizontal pole 311 that the level was placed and setting firmly in the montant 31 of horizontal pole 311 bottom surface central point department, the vertical setting of montant 31, four tip of the horizontal pole 311 of cross form are respectively in four well pole 21's top fixed connection.
Referring to fig. 3 and 4, the vertical rod 31 is hinged with two C-shaped abutting rods 32 with downward openings, the rotation axes of the two abutting rods 32 are perpendicular to each other, the two abutting rods 32 are distributed along the length direction of the vertical rod 31, the openings of the abutting rods 32 are arranged towards the cover 12, the end portions of the abutting rods 32 are fixedly provided with hemispherical ball heads 33, and the four supporting components are respectively aligned with the four end portions of the two abutting rods 32 in the direction perpendicular to the connecting rod 3. When two ends of one abutting rod 32 abut against the cover 12 at the same time, two ends of the other abutting rod 32 also abut against the top surface of the cover 12. A locking member 26 capable of fixing the middle bar 21 at the current position is provided on the sleeve 211 on the slider 23, and the locking member 26 in this embodiment is a nut 27 screwed on the sleeve 211. The elastic member 24 for driving the middle rod 21 to move upwards is fixedly connected inside the sleeve 211, the elastic member 24 in this embodiment is a spring 25, the bottom end of the spring 25 is fixedly connected to the inner side wall of the sleeve 211, the top end of the spring 25 is fixedly connected to the end portion of the middle rod 21 inside the sleeve 211, and when the bottom end of the middle rod 21 and the top end of the sleeve 211 are level in the horizontal direction, the spring 25 is in a natural state.
